Fitzgerald Moving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Fitzgerald Moving in the United States is $69,994.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$34. Salaries at Fitzgerald Moving typically range from $61,397 to $79,671 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Minneapolis?

Understanding the cost of living near Minneapolis is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Fitzgerald Moving.
Minneapolis' Cost of Living Index is approximately 104.8 (4.8% more expensive than US average; 7.9% more than MN average). Major city, vibrant, housing costs above US avg, cold winters (high heating). Metro Transit.
